Job description

Job responsibilities

The Role

As a Clinical Pharmacist you will confidently act within professional boundaries, supporting and working alongside a team of pharmacists.

You will help resolve medication-related issues, help utilise skill mix, improve patient outcomes and ensure better access to healthcare.

You will support practice staff with prescription and medication queries.

You will be required to work Monday to Friday with a 37.5 hour working week

Main duties of the job

  • As a clinical pharmacist you will confidently act within professional boundaries, supporting and working alongside a team of pharmacists and GP's.

  • Resolve medication-related issues

  • Help to utilise skill mix

  • Improve patient outcomes

  • Ensure better access to healthcare

  • Support practice staff with prescription and medication queries

  • Medicine reconciliation

  • Provide expert advice in clinical medicines

  • Deliver clinical leadership on medicines optimisation and quality improvement

  • Manage and monitor drug administration

  • Ensure proper and efficient use of medication

  • Educate patients on medication and disease prevention

  • Create and follow clinical pharmacy programme according to practice policy

 

Previous primary care experience and being proficient with EMIS or System 1 is preferred, although as this role is onsite, training can be provided
